Employer contracts with an independent contractor to install or construct a ceiling as specified and agreed upon in the contract. Please note that this Agreement is intended for general use. Your state law may require that additional or different provisions be included for agreements between a homeowner and a contractor for work on the home. In this instance, please consult your local law, local government or legal counsel.

Pennsylvania law requires contractors working on home improvements to be registered with the Attorney General's office. This law aims to protect consumers from fraud and ensure that contractors meet specific standards. Understanding these regulations is crucial when entering into a Pennsylvania Self-Employed Ceiling Installation Contract, as it helps ensure compliance and consumer protection.

Every contract, including a Pennsylvania Self-Employed Ceiling Installation Contract, must contain five essential elements. These elements are offer, acceptance, consideration, capacity, and legality. Each element plays a crucial role in making the contract binding and enforceable. Understanding these components can help you create a solid contract that protects your interests.
